Located just 24 miles from St. George Island, Apalachicola is a charming historic town that offers visitors a perfect day trip destination during their SGI island vacation. This small coastal community, nestled along the Forgotten Coast, is a treasure trove of history, culture, and culinary delights that captures the essence of Old Florida.
A Rich Maritime History
The town’s working waterfront tells a story of generations of fishermen and oystermen. Historic maritime buildings line the streets, and you can still watch shrimp boats coming and going from the harbor. The iconic harbor reflects Apalachicola’s long-standing relationship with the sea, with colorful fishing vessels bobbing against a backdrop of historic buildings.

Culinary Delights
Apalachicola is renowned for its world-famous oysters, and the local restaurants showcase this delicacy in countless ways. Must-visit dining spots include:
- Up the Creek Raw Bar: Offering fresh seafood with waterfront views
- The Gibson Inn’s restaurant and bar: A historic spot with classic Southern cuisine
- Water Street Hotel & Restaurant: Known for its innovative local dishes
- Boss Oyster: A local favorite for the freshest oysters imaginable

Practical Visitor Information
The drive from St. George Island takes approximately 30-40 minutes, making it an ideal day trip. The town is small enough to explore thoroughly in a day, but rich enough to warrant multiple visits during your vacation.
